在数字化时代,网站配置文件如同建筑的地基,承载着功能实现与安全稳定的双重使命。借助FTP工具对核心配置文件进行精准定位与修改,已成为运维人员和开发者必备的基础技能。这种技术手段不仅能快速修复漏洞、优化性能,还能动态调整网站行为,其重要性贯穿于网站生命周期的每个环节。
一、前期准备与工具选择
工欲善其事,必先利其器。主流FTP客户端如FileZilla、WinSCP等因其跨平台兼容性与可视化界面,成为操作的首选方案。FileZilla支持拖拽式传输和SSH密钥认证的特性,使其在处理大规模文件时展现高效性能,而WinSCP的脚本自动化功能适合需要批量修改的场景。
连接前的信息筹备尤为关键。服务器地址通常采用IP或域名形式,端口号默认为21或22(SFTP),用户需从服务商处获取加密凭证。对于WordPress等常见系统,wp-config.php文件往往位于网站根目录;而Apache服务器的httpd.conf配置文件则多存储于/etc/httpd路径,这些路径规律需要提前掌握。
二、核心文件的定位逻辑
配置文件往往遵循特定命名规则,如nginx.conf、settings.py、web.config等,其存储层级与网站框架密切相关。在Linux系统中,/etc目录集中存放全局配置,而/var/www则常见网页文件。通过FTP客户端的树状目录导航功能,可结合关键词搜索快速定位目标文件。
多层验证机制可能影响文件访问。某些CMS系统采用权限隔离设计,核心配置文件仅对特定用户组开放读写权限。此时需要通过FTP工具修改文件属性,将644改为755模式以获取修改权限,操作完成后需及时恢复原始权限设置以防止安全风险。

三、安全修改的技术要点
修改前的备份策略不可或缺。专业开发者常采用版本控制系统,而运维人员可通过FTP工具下载文件副本至本地,并添加.bak后缀存档。对于重要配置文件,建议建立修改日志,记录变更时间、内容及操作者信息,这对故障回溯具有重要价值。
字符编码与传输模式直接影响文件完整性。当遇到配置文件乱码时,需将FTP客户端字符集设置为UTF-8,并禁用ASCII传输模式。Linux系统下的换行符(LF)与Windows(CRLF)差异可能导致脚本失效,使用Notepad++等专业编辑器可自动识别并转换编码格式。
四、常见问题与排查思路
连接失败多由网络环境引起。企业防火墙可能拦截21端口流量,此时可尝试切换为被动模式或启用SFTP协议。阿里云等公有云平台需在安全组中放行特定端口,而本地服务器需检查iptables规则是否允许FTP数据传输。
文件锁定状态常导致修改失败。某些Web服务器在运行时会锁定配置文件,修改前需先停止Apache/Nginx服务。对于实时性要求高的场景,可采用热重载命令(如nginx -s reload)使新配置即时生效,避免服务中断。日志分析工具能有效追踪配置错误,FileZilla的传输日志可显示具体报错代码,为诊断提供关键线索。
插件下载说明
未提供下载提取码的插件,都是站长辛苦开发!需要的请联系本站客服或者站长!
织梦二次开发QQ群
本站客服QQ号:862782808(点击左边QQ号交流),群号(383578617)
如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 如何通过FTP工具查找并修改网站的核心配置文件































